Pakistan Rugby Union Signs MoU with UMT
Pakistan Rugby Union (PRU) has officially sign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with the University of Management and Technology (UMT) Lahore marking an important step towards the growth of rugby in Pakistan.
Under this partnership, PRU will support the development of a structured rugby program at UMT, providing technical expertise and opportunities for student participation at national and regional levels.
In return, UMT has extended its full support by offering access to its facilities, including the university grounds for matches and training camps, as well as venues for coaching courses, workshops, and other rugby development activities.
This collaboration will create new opportunities for students and athletes, promoting rugby as a fast growing sport in Pakistan and establish the pathway for youth to represent at higher levels.

A New Era of Rugby Development Begins in South Punjab
Fort Abbas (South Punjab). A new era for rugby has officially begun in South Punjab under the initiative of Muzamil Wazari, with rugby development sessions kicking off in Fort Abbas. The initiative has sparked great enthusiasm, as local boys displayed high energy and excitement throughout the training sessions.
This program marks the start of a dedicated effort to bring more youth into rugby, providing them with structured opportunities to learn, play, and grow through the sport. The sessions are already proving that rugby has a natural home in South Punjab, with players showing eagerness to embrace the game and its values of teamwork, respect, and resilience.
Speaking on the launch, officials noted that this is the foundation for a long term vision:
• U20 rugby clubs will be developed in 2025.
• The program will expand to senior men’s rugby in 2026.
• Schools, colleges, and communities will be engaged to build a strong pathway for players.
This is more than just a sporting project.it is about empowering our youth, building character, and giving them a platform to succeed,” said the organizers.
This Initiative and the passion of the young athletes provide confidence that South Punjab will emerge as a key hub for rugby in Pakistan.

Girls’ Triangle Rugby Series – Bahawalnagar

The Girls’ Triangle Rugby Series was successfully held at Bahawalnagar, with participation from Bahawalnagar, Sheikhupura, and Fort Abbas. The young athletes displayed great passion, commitment, and competitive rugby throughout the event.

Sheikhupura emerged as the champions of the Girls’ Triangle Rugby Series, showcasing excellent skills, teamwork, and determination.

This successful event was made possible through the continuous efforts of the Pakistan Rugby Union (PRU) in promoting women’s rugby across the country. PRU’s commitment to creating opportunities for girls at grassroots level is helping to grow the game, develop new talent, and inspire future athletes.

Pakistan Rugby Union Conducts Strength & Conditioning Course with Beaconhouse School System.
Pakistan Rugby Union (PRU) successfully organized a Strength & Conditioning (S&C) Course in collaboration with Beaconhouse School System, Lahore Region. The course was held on 29th August 2025 and brought together enthusiastic participants excited to enhance their knowledge and practical skills in Strength & Conditioning.
The session was coordinated by Ms. Tania Mallick from Beaconhouse School System, whose efforts ensured smooth ex*****on and active engagement from all participants. The course covered modern S&C practices, rugby values, and safe training methods to help young athletes maximize performance and minimize injury risks.
The collaboration with Beaconhouse is part of PRU’s ongoing commitment to spreading S&C /Rugby education, safeguarding values, and providing professional development opportunities across Pakistan.
